I'm not claiming this as the greatest thing since sliced bread but it is quite a nice side-effect of Safari's autofill function.
The annoying thing about sites like eBay is that you don't get an instant list of previous searches (I pick eBay because I first found this there, but it is of course generic). But if you have Safari's autofill switched on, then if you return to a page where you've already done a search, typing the first few letters of that search makes the whole text reappear.
And because Safari ties all this to the particular web page, the autofill doesn't turn up anywhere else.
Like I said, not earth shattering but it makes my life just that little bit easier. I'm running OS 10.2.6 and Safari 1.0.85...
